F1 team in new young driver move

Tue, 19 Jul 2005

Lucky Strike BAR Honda has announced the first results from its Young Driver Programme which aims to find the F1 stars of tomorrow.

Since the end of the 2004 season the team has been running the programme from which it hopes to cherry-pick the best of tomorrow's bright young things.

Three drivers have been picked from the nine hopefuls, all from various junior formulae, to join BAR at this week's test in Jerez.

"The Young Driver initiative which we are putting into place at BAR is the result of a considerable period of careful planning and research," explained Race Engineer Jock Clear.

"The investment from the team has been substantial and so far we are pleased with the results seen and the commitment of all the drivers who have participated.

However, he pointed out that the initiative "is not about finding an immediate understudy" for the current BAR team drivers.

"The Young Driver Programme is about nurturing talent and giving the drivers the support needed to make it to the very top of motorsport," he added.

The three chosen drivers will each get two half-day sessions in the BAR car at Jerez so they can experience a fully functional F1 race car.
